VAC AERO shipped a horizontal vacuum furnace to an international company’s plant in Mexico to process aerospace parts. The furnace features an all-metal hot zone with a work chamber of 48 x 48 x 60 inches with a 4,000-pound load capacity. It utilizes gas cooling to 2-bar absolute pressure and operates at temperatures of 1000-2200°F (538-1205°C). The furnace is also equipped with a 35-inch diffusion pump and VAC AERO’s HC900 control system. A key feature is the ability to independently control the work zones for optimal uniformity as well as the ability to program heat-treatment cycles that can then be run automatically and accurately, allowing the operator to achieve the specific structure and properties required for their application.
